๐Ÿข About PauseAI

PauseAI is a unique advocacy organization focused exclusively on convincing governments to pause superhuman AI development through public education, policy engagement, and protest organization. Unlike typical tech companies, it operates as a global movement with volunteer chapters, offering the chance to work on one of humanity's most pressing existential risks. This role appeals to those who want to shape public discourse on AI safety while working in a mission-driven, decentralized structure.

About This Role

As Communications Director at PauseAI, you'll architect the entire communications functionโ€”from strategy to scalable systemsโ€”serving as the central nervous system connecting global volunteers and chapters. You'll develop narrative frameworks, design information pipelines from AI news monitoring to content production, and empower volunteers to communicate effectively. This role is impactful because your work directly enables a growing global movement to advocate coherently for pausing superhuman AI development.

๐Ÿ’ก A Day in the Life

A typical day might involve reviewing AI news developments to identify communication opportunities, collaborating with chapter leaders to adapt global messaging for local contexts, and refining content production systems for volunteer contributors. You'd likely spend time developing training materials, analyzing communication metrics for volunteer engagement, and working with the CEO to align communications with strategic advocacy goals across different regions and audiences.
